Output a1685421c21652fd367671c8a4c1a95256bc1207d6bf8f827827a512d247fc14:42
- value
- 1380538
- script pubkey
- OP_0 OP_PUSHBYTES_20 50aa0890d34c662d3315b5ed79522a20efbb1d71
- address
- bc1q2z4q3yxnf3nz6vc4khkhj532yrhmk8t3fckgf9
- transaction
- a1685421c21652fd367671c8a4c1a95256bc1207d6bf8f827827a512d247fc14
- confirmations
- 75496
- spent
- true